Linux操作系统中,Firewalld防火墙相关操作如下:
安装
yum install firewalld firewalld-config
Firewall开启常见端口命令
新增端口:
firewall-cmd --zone=public --add-port=80/tcp --permanentfirewall-cmd --zone=public --add-port=443/tcp --permanentfirewall-cmd --zone=public --add-port=22/tcp --permanentfirewall-cmd --zone=public --add-port=21/tcp --permanentfirewall-cmd --zone=public --add-port=53/udp --permanent
关闭端口
firewall-cmd --zone=public --remove-port=80/tcp --permanentfirewall-cmd --zone=public --remove-port=443/tcp --permanentfirewall-cmd --zone=public --remove-port=22/tcp --permanentfirewall-cmd --zone=public --remove-port=21/tcp --permanentfirewall-cmd --zone=public --remove-port=53/udp --permanent
防火墙常见操作
# 启动防火墙
systemctl start firewalld.service# 重启防火墙,添加或删除之后需要重启
firewall-cmd --reload
# 或者
service firewalld restart# 查看端口列表
firewall-cmd --permanent --list-port# 禁用防火墙
systemctl stop firewalld# 查看状态
systemctl status firewalld
# 或者
firewalld-cmd --state